Safra Sukkah
The Safra Sukkah, the largest Sukkah in the country (about 1,000 meters), will be open to the public over the intermediate days of Sukkot from September 18-26. All events at the Sukkah are free, and visitors are invited to bring food and eat in the Sukkah or just hang out. The theme of this year's Sukkah is light, and the Sukkah will be decorated with unique and innovative lights.
The Sukkah will be open all day. During the morning hours there will be no special activities. Activities and shows will take place from 17:00-23:00. On Saturday nights and on days that holidays end, the Sukkah will open at 20:30.
Sukkah events:
This year's events include workshops for kids and live performances by David Lavi, Shai Tsabari, Boaz Banai, and Hamadregot.
